美文网首页
YUV图像编码格式

YUV图像编码格式

作者: 平原河流 | 来源:发表于2019-10-28 10:50 被阅读0次

    YUV,是一种颜色编码方法。常使用在各个视频处理组件中。YUV在对照片或视频编码时,考虑到人类的感知能力,允许降低色度的带宽。

    YUV是编译true-color颜色空间(colorspace)的种类,Y'UV,YUV,YCbCr,YPbPr等专有名词都可以称为YUV,彼此有重叠。“Y”表示明亮度(Luminance、Luma),“U”和“V”则是色度、浓度(Chrominance、Chroma)。

    Y′UV,YUV,YCbCr,YPbPr所指涉的范围,常有混淆或重叠的情况。从历史的演变来说,其中YUV和Y'UV通常用来编码电视的模拟信号,而YCbCr则是用来描述数字的视频信号,适合视频与图片压缩以及传输,例如MPEG、JPEG。但在现今,YUV通常已经在电脑系统上广泛使用。

    Y'代表明亮度(luma;brightness)而U与V存储色度(色讯;chrominance;color)部分;亮度(luminance)记作Y,而Y'的prime符号记作伽玛校正。

    YUVFormats分成两个格式:
    紧缩格式(packedformats):将Y、U、V值存储成MacroPixels数组,和RGB的存放方式类似。
    平面格式(planarformats):将Y、U、V的三个分量分别存放在不同的矩阵中。

    紧缩格式(packedformat)中的YUV是混合在一起的,对于YUV4:4:4格式而言,用紧缩格式很合适的,因此就有了UYVY、YUYV等。平面格式(planarformats)是指每Y分量,U分量和V分量都是以独立的平面组织的,也就是说所有的U分量必须在Y分量后面,而V分量在所有的U分量后面,此一格式适用于采样(subsample)。

    平面格式(planarformat)有I420(4:2:0)、YV12、NV12、NV21等。

    I420


    I420

    YV12


    YV12

    NV12


    NV12

    NV21


    NV21

    相关文章

      网友评论

          本文标题:YUV图像编码格式

          本文链接:https://www.haomeiwen.com/subject/hlkqkqtx.html